Alliant National Title Hires Regulatory Compliance Officer

November 17, 2015

Alliant National Title Insurance Company has hired Elyce Schweitzer as its new regulatory compliance officer and vice president.

Schweitzer’s main focus with her new role will be to provide guidance on regulatory requirements for compliance with applicable title insurance laws, while spearheading all relevant research and analysis.

“I am delighted to work with the amazing group of dedicated and talented individuals that comprise Alliant National Title Insurance Company,” Schweitzer said. “Becoming a part of this team is a dream come true for me.”

Schweitzer’s experience includes working in law and real estate for over 20 years. Previously, she was claims counsel for First American Title Insurance Co. before joining Commonwealth Land Title Insurance Co.

Schweitzer opened her own company in 2010, representing parties and mediating foreclosure cases. She is a member of the Florida Bar, the New York Bar and the U.S. District Court, Middle District of Florida. She has also acted as Florida Supreme Court certified circuit civil mediator, and is a certified project management professional. In addition, Schweitzer is an adjunct instructor at Valencia College, where she teaches both project management and ethics classes.
